9.  REGISTER FILE (RF)
The register file is a group of registers that mainly control the CPU peripheral circuits.  The register file has
a capacity of 128 words 
×
 4 bits.  However, peripheral circuit addresses are actually allocated to the high-order
64 nibbles (00H-3FH) and addresses 40H-7FH of the currently selected bank of data memory to the low-order
64 nibbles (40H-7FH).
This means that 40H-7FH of each bank of data memory belongs to both the data memory address space
and the register file address space.
In the assembler, the control register file is allocated to 80H-BFH.
